2009-05-06 1 views
0

최근에 일부 고객이 내 웹 사이트의 속도 저하에 대해 불평하는 것을 보았습니다. 문제는 해당 네트워크와 관련이 있습니다. 나는 이것을 자신에게 더 철저히 정당화 할 수 있기를 바랄뿐 아니라 그들이 내 문을 두드리기 전에 네트워크 문제가있는 것으로 보이는 고객에게보다 적극적으로 연락 할 수 있기를 바랍니다.응용 프로그램 로그 (Coldfusion/J2EE)와 IIS 로그를 연결하여 클라이언트 네트워크 문제 디버그

ASP.Net을 실행하는 경우 Response.AppendToLog Method을 사용하고 토큰을 추가하여 사용자 지정 응용 프로그램 수준 로깅 (사용자, 클라이언트, 처리 시간 등)을 모두 되돌릴 수 있습니다. ASP.net 없이는 할 수있는 방법을 찾지 못하는 것 같습니다. ASP의 ISAPI에 내장되어 있다고 생각합니다. 내 요청은 IIS를 통해 JRun의 ColdFusion ISAPI (.cfm/ .cfc 파일)로 전달됩니다.

클라이언트가 요청을 처리하는 데 걸린 시간이 아닌 콘텐츠를 수신하는 데 걸린 시간을 가장 잘 알고 싶습니다.

내가보기에 가치가 있다고 생각지 않는 다른 장소/정보가있는 경우 알려 주시기 바랍니다. 아마도 HTTP.sys에서 정보를 어떻게 든 기록해야합니까?

모든 요청에 ​​대해 쿠키를 설정할 수 있으며 IIS에서 기록한 쿠키를 사용할 수 있다는 것을 알고 있습니다. 더 나은 솔루션이되기를 바랍니다.

의견을 보내 주셔서 감사합니다.

답변

0

Jiffy을 참조하십시오. 이것은 "실제 웹 페이지의 계측 및 측정을위한 엔드 투 엔드 (end-to-end) 웹 페이지 도구입니다."

introductory video은 좋은 개요를 제공합니다.